FFracFluxFromRelK Class Reference

#include <fmobfromkpermlib.h>

Inheritance diagram for FFracFluxFromRelK:
Inheritance graph
[legend]
Collaboration diagram for FFracFluxFromRelK:
Collaboration graph
[legend]

List of all members.

Public Member Functions

virtual double operator() (double x, unsigned cmp=0) const
 FFracFluxFromRelK (Function1D &fk1, Function1D &fk2, double sr1, double sr2, double v1, double v2)
virtual ~FFracFluxFromRelK ()

Protected Attributes

Function1D_fk1
Function1D_fk2
double _sr1
double _sr1Max
double _M

Detailed Description

Definition at line 8 of file fmobfromkpermlib.h.


Constructor & Destructor Documentation

FFracFluxFromRelK::FFracFluxFromRelK ( Function1D fk1,
Function1D fk2,
double  sr1,
double  sr2,
double  v1,
double  v2 
) [inline]

Definition at line 29 of file fmobfromkpermlib.h.

00030    :_fk1(fk1),_fk2(fk2),_sr1(sr1),_sr1Max(1.0-sr2)
00031   {
00032     
00033     _M=v1/v2;
00034   }

virtual FFracFluxFromRelK::~FFracFluxFromRelK (  )  [inline, virtual]

Definition at line 37 of file fmobfromkpermlib.h.

00037 {}


Member Function Documentation

virtual double FFracFluxFromRelK::operator() ( double  x,
unsigned  cmp = 0 
) const [inline, virtual]

Implements Function1D.

Definition at line 17 of file fmobfromkpermlib.h.

00018   {
00019     /*
00020     if (x < _sr1) 
00021       return 0.0;
00022     if (x >= _sr1Max)
00023       return 1;
00024     */
00025     double fk1=_fk1(x);
00026     return fk1/(fk1 + _M*_fk2(x));
00027   }


Member Data Documentation

Definition at line 13 of file fmobfromkpermlib.h.

Definition at line 13 of file fmobfromkpermlib.h.

double FFracFluxFromRelK::_M [protected]

Definition at line 15 of file fmobfromkpermlib.h.

double FFracFluxFromRelK::_sr1 [protected]

Definition at line 14 of file fmobfromkpermlib.h.

double FFracFluxFromRelK::_sr1Max [protected]

Definition at line 14 of file fmobfromkpermlib.h.


The documentation for this class was generated from the following file: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ines
Generated on Sun Apr 8 23:13:05 2012 for CO2INJECTION by  doxygen 1.6.3